The all-new Tata Sierra has arrived at a starting price of Rs. 11.49 lakh (ex-showroom), and apart from its nostalgic nameplate and design, its variant and powertrain strategy is another headline, catching attention. The Sierra is available in 7 variants and 3 engine options, and 5 transmission options, which gives buyers more flexibility to choose the right model for them. In this article, we break down each variant and explain which powertrain you get with them. 

2025 Tata Sierra Powertrain Options 

Before we dive into the variants, let's have a look at the three engine options that are offered on the new Sierra. The options include a new 1.5-litre naturally aspirated petrol engine, a new 1.5-litre turbo petrol engine, and Tata’s tried and tested 1.5-litre diesel engine, which also powers the Nexon and Curvv. The NA petrol and diesel engines are available with manual and automatic transmission options, whereas the new turbo-petrol is only available with a 6-speed automatic transmission. 2025 Tata Sierra Smart+

Starting with the base Smart+ variant, it is offered with the new 1.5-litre naturally aspirated petrol and the 1.5-litre diesel engines. Transmission option is limited to a 6-speed manual; no automatic transmission for this variant. 

2025 Tata Sierra Pure

The Pure variant is not very different from the Smart+. This variant also gets the 1.5-litre NA petrol and the 1.5-litre diesel engines, but you get the option to choose a manual or an automatic gearbox with the engine, which makes it the most affordable automatic variant in the Sierra lineup.

2025 Tata Sierra Pure+

Powertrain options on the Pure+ variant are based on the Pure variant. It gets the same engine and transmission options, which include both the 1.5-litre NA petrol and the 1.5-litre diesel engines, available in both manual and automatic gearbox options.

2025 Tata Sierra Adventure

Moving up to the Adventure variant, this is the mid-spec variant in the Sierra lineup and is offered with the 1.5-litre naturally aspirated petrol and the 1.5-litre diesel engines. The petrol engine is available in both a 6-speed manual and 7-speed dual-clutch automatic; however, the diesel engine can be had only in the 6-speed manual gearbox. 

2025 Tata Sierra Adventure+

The new turbo-petrol range of the Sierra starts from the Adventure+ variant. All 3 engines are available with this variant. The 1.5-litre turbo petrol engine is available exclusively in a 6-speed torque converter automatic gearbox across the range, while the 1.5-litre diesel can be had in both manual and automatic gearbox options in this variant. The 1.5-litre naturally aspirated petrol engine is, however, available only in the manual avatar for the Adventure+.

2025 Tata Sierra Accomplished

The powertrain options story of the Accomplished variant is the same as what we have seen in the Adventure+. All three engines are available here, with the 1.5-litre NA engine being offered in only a 6-speed manual gearbox.

2025 Tata Sierra Accomplished+

The Accomplished+ is the top-spec variant of the Tata Sierra, but it is not offered with the 1.5-litre naturally aspirated petrol engine. The engine options for this top-spec variant are the 1.5-litre diesel, available in both manual and automatic transmission options, and the 1.5-litre turbo petrol engine with an automatic gearbox.

2025 Tata Sierra Price and Rivals

Tata Sierra is now available at an introductory price of Rs. 11.49 lakh (ex-showroom) and is offered in a total of 7 variants. Bookings are set to open on December 16, and the full pricing list will be announced in the first week of December, with deliveries slated to begin from January 15, 2026.

The new Sierra will take on segment contenders like the Kia Seltos, Hyundai Creta, Maruti Suzuki Victoris, Maruti Suzuki Grand Vitara, Toyota Urban Cruiser Hyryder, Honda Elevate, MG Astor, and in-house rival in the form of the Tata Curvv. Not to forget the German siblings, the Skoda Kushaq and the Volkswagen Taigun. Renault's upcoming 2026 Duster and its sibling, the Nissan Tekton, are also expected to be other contenders against the Sierra.
